  • Thomas Cleij reappointed as Dean of the Faculty of Science and Engineering

    20-12-2022

    The Executive Board of Maastricht University has reappointed prof. dr. Thomas Cleij as Dean of the Faculty of Science and Engineering. Cleij will continue to lead the fast-growing faculty until March 2027.

  • Mark Winands

    Machines that can improvise

    15-12-2022

    Computers are already capable of making independent decisions in familiar situations. But can they also apply knowledge to new facts? Mark Winands, the new professor of Machine Reasoning at the Department of Advanced Computing Sciences, develops computer programs that behave as rational agents.

  • casal_data_2022

    Causal Data Science Meeting 2022

    13-12-2022

    On 7-8 November, Maastricht University's School of Business and Economics and Copenhagen Business School organised the Causal Data Science Meeting 2022. The event attracted more than 1,900 virtual attendees and welcomed the 2011 Turing Award Winner Judea Pearl as well as fairness and causality expert Silvia Chiappa, Group Leader of Causal Intelligence team at Google DeepMind.

  • MOVARE

    Poor classroom air negatively affects learning performance

    09-12-2022

    Since the corona crisis, school ventilation has been in the spotlight, especially to prevent the spread of the SARS-Cov-2 virus. Research published today by Maastricht University (UM) shows that poor ventilation also affects the test scores of elementary school students and thus the core task of schools, good education.
